PRIME Bridge CMM

High-end Precision Measurement

The PRIME Bridge CMM is engineered around an equilateral triangle beam — a geometry that delivers thermal balance and isotropy in all directions, so measurement results stay consistent whether you’re running a quick inspection or a full-shift production cycle.

Built on a natural granite base with aviation-grade aluminum alloy construction, the PRIME maintains micron-level repeatability under real workshop conditions — not just in a controlled lab. Structure of Equilateral Triangle Beam

Uniform stiffness in all directions means no measurement drift as the machine moves — the equilateral triangle beam geometry keeps the axis geometry consistent whether you’re probing at the center or the edge of the work envelope.

Flexible Synchronous Belt Drive

Flexible Synchronous Belt Drive

The flexible synchronous belt with built-in steel wire, takes into account the flexible meshing and rigid axial transmission, which eliminates the vibration and jitter generated during the movement and ensures the good high-precision positioning performance of the coordinate measuring machine.

Efficient Dynamic
Measurement Performance

Manual mode: up to 20mm/s (slow) / 100mm/s (standard). CNC single-axis: 300mm/s. CNC spatial velocity: 520mm/s. Fast enough to keep up with production — precise enough for metrology lab work.
